Tbilisi Transport Company has announced a tender for the design and construction of a new tram line, marking a significant step toward restoring tram services in the city. The announcement was made by Mayor Kakha Kaladze during a municipal government meeting. The tender covers the preparation of design and budgetary documentation, as well as the construction and installation works for a line connecting Didi Dighomi and Didube.

“Everyone will remember our pre-election pledge to bring the tram back to Tbilisi. Now, Tbilisi Transport Company has announced a tender for the design and construction of a tram line using the Design-Build method,” said Kakha Kaladze.

The new line will run from the intersection of Didi Dighomi’s 3rd and 4th microdistricts to the Didube metro station, primarily along Davit Agmashenebeli Avenue, covering a total length of 7.5 kilometers with 11 stops. The project also includes the construction of a tram depot capable of servicing 10 to 11 tram sets, featuring administrative and production facilities, covered storage, washing stations, emergency access points, and all essential engineering systems.

Mayor Kaladze emphasized the importance of the project in improving urban mobility, stating that the tram line will connect residents of Didi Dighomi with the metro system, making travel toward the city center faster and more comfortable.

The tender closes at the end of December 2025, and the winning company will have 36 months to complete the project. Mayor Kaladze expressed hope for broad participation, underscoring the city’s commitment to reviving Tbilisi’s tram network.
